802.11ac access point for home and small branch offices The multifunctional Aruba 203R Remote AP delivers secure and fast IEEE 802.11ac wireless and wired network access to corporate resources for branch and home offices.
Unique in the industry, the compact Aruba 203R Unified Remote Access Point is software-configurable to operate in either 1x1 dual radio mode, or 2x2 single radio mode. It supports up to 867Mbps in the 5GHz band or up to 400Mbps in the 2.4 GHz band when operating in single radio 2x2 mode. In dual radio 1x1 mode, the maximum data rates for the 203R AP are 433Mbps in the 5GHz band and 200Mbps in the 2.4GHz band.
The 203R AP offers a variety of enterprise-class features, including role-based network access, policy-based forwarding, and Adaptive Radio Management (ARM), which gives remote workers the same high-quality Wi-Fi experience they get at corporate headquarters. When additional capacity is desired, this low-cost 203R AP can be quickly added to an existing Aruba WLAN to improve network performance.
Managed by the Aruba Mobility Controller, the 203R AP supports centralized configuration, data encryption, policy enforcement and network services. It extends corporate resources to remote locations by establishing site-to-site VPN tunnels to the data center.
For large installations across multiple sites, the Aruba Activate service significantly reduces deployment time by automating device provisioning, firmware upgrades, and inventory management. With Aruba Activate, APs can configure themselves when powered up, slashing the cost and time to deploy wireless in remote branches and home offices. |

Standard Features
|
Unique Benefits
- The 203R can be deployed in either controller-based (ArubaOS) or controller-less (InstantOS) deployment mode.
- The 203R AP is software configurable to operate in either 1x1 dual radio mode, or 2x2 single radio mode. - Supports up to 867Mbps in the 5GHz band (with 2SS/VHT80 clients) or up to 400Mbps in the 2.4 GHz band (with 2SS/VHT40 clients). In 1x1 dual radio mode, these max speeds are up to 433Mbps (5GHz) and 200Mbps (2.4GHz).
- Delivers location-based services for BLE-enabled mobile devices. - Enables management of your deployment of battery- powered Aruba Beacons.
- Minimizes the impact from out-of-band interference from sources such as 3G/4G cellular networks.
- Adaptive Radio Management (ARM) technology automatically assigns channel and power settings, provides airtime fairness and ensures that APs stay clear of all sources of RF interference to deliver reliable, high-performance WLANs - The 203R can be configured to provide part-time or dedicated air monitoring for wireless intrusion protection, VPN tunnels to extend remote locations to corporate resources, and wireless mesh connections where Ethernet drops are not available.
- Integrated wireless intrusion protection offers threat protection and mitigation, and eliminates the need for separate RF sensors and security appliances. - IP reputation and security services identify, classify, and block malicious files, URLs and IPs, providing comprehensive protection against advanced online threats. - Integrated Trusted Platform Module (TPM) for secure storage of credentials, certificates and keys.
- AppRF technology leverages deep packet inspection to classify and block, prioritize, or limit bandwidth for thousands of applications in a range of categories.
- Supports priority handling and policy enforcement for unified communication apps, including Microsoft Skype for Business with encrypted videoconferencing, voice, chat and desktop sharing. |

WIFI Antennas Two integrated dual-band omni-directional antennas for 2x2 MIMO with maximum individual antenna gain of 0.9dBi in 2.4GHz and 2.9dBi in 5GHz. Built-in antennas are optimized for vertical orientation of the AP. - Combining the patterns of each of the antennas of the MIMO radios, the peak gain of the effective per-antenna pattern is -1dBi in 2.4GHz and 0.9dBi in 5GHz. | |

WIFI Radio Specifications
- 5GHz 802.11ac 2x2 MIMO OR 2.4GHz 802.11n 2x2 MIMO Notes: 256-QAM modulation (802.11ac) supported by the 2.4GHz radio as well - 5GHz 802.11ac 1x1 AND 2.4GHz 802.11n 1x1
- 2.400 to 2.4835GHz - 5.150 to 5.250GHz - 5.250 to 5.350GHz - 5.470 to 5.725GHz - 5.725 to 5.850GHz
- 802.11b: Direct-sequence spread-spectrum (DSSS) - 802.11a/g/n/ac: Orthogonal frequency-division multiplexing (OFDM)
- 802.11b: BPSK, QPSK, CCK - 802.11a/g/n/ac: BPSK, QPSK, 16-QAM, 64-QAM, 256-QAM
- 2.4GHz band: +18 dBm per chain, +21 dBm aggregate (2x2 mode) - 5GHz band: +18 dBm per chain, +21 dBm aggregate (2x2 mode) Notes: Conducted transmit power levels exclude antenna gain. For total (EIRP) transmit power, add antenna gain
- 802.11b: 1, 2, 5.5, 11 - 802.11a/g: 6, 9, 12, 18, 24, 36, 48, 54 - 802.11n: 6.5 to 300 (MCS0 to MCS15) - 802.11ac: 6.5 to 867 (MCS0 to MCS9, NSS = 1 to 2 for VHT20/40/80)
